BRISKPE Unveils New Solutions to Help Indian Amazon Sellers Scale Globally

BRISKPE

BRISKPE, a Prosus-backed and Amazon-approved Payment Service Provider (PSP), has announced the launch of ‘BRISKPE Launchpad,’ a new initiative designed to revolutionise how Indian sellers expand their businesses globally. Officially approved as a Payment Service Provider (PSP) by Amazon, BRISKPE is moving beyond just powering payouts to building a full-stack ecosystem that helps sellers scale like global brands.

“Cross-border commerce should ignite ambition, not intimidate it,” said Sanjay Tripathy, Co-founder and CEO of BRISKPE. “Our PSP approval from Amazon affirms the strength of our payment infrastructure. But with BRISKPE Launchpad, we go several steps further. We’re building a support system that gives Indian MSMEs the tools, partnerships, and confidence to succeed globally. We’re also in active discussions with platforms like Shopify, Etsy, eBay, and Walmart to extend this ecosystem to a wider base of sellers.”

BRISKPE simplifies cross-border payments for MSME exporters and importers, making global transactions faster, more cost-effective, and seamless. Launched in 2023, the fintech platform leverages cutting-edge technology to provide real-time tracking, local virtual accounts, competitive forex rates, and bank-grade compliance.

Until now, Indian MSMEs, despite contributing 45% of India’s exports, have struggled with fragmented infrastructure. Payment delays, unpredictable forex rates, complex tax regulations, and compliance chaos have made global selling a daunting task. Most small sellers juggle multiple service providers, often with no single point of accountability. With PSP approval from Amazon, BRISKPE is among one of the few Indian fintech companies authorised to facilitate direct payouts from Amazon’s global marketplaces—including the US, UK, Europe, Singapore, and Australia.

The core of this transformation is ‘BRISKPE Launchpad’, a partner-powered growth engine built atop BRISKPE’s real-time payments and compliance stack. The Launchpad offers Indian Amazon sellers a complete suite of enablers: global shipping partners, tax consultants, marketplace experts, account managers, and compliance advisors—all curated and integrated into one seamless platform. Sellers also benefit from BRISKPE’s payment stack of instant virtual accounts in local currencies, live forex rates with zero hidden markups, real-time payment tracking, and compliance documents like E-FIRA and E-BRCs. With a strong focus on efficiency and transparency, BRISKPE simplifies inward and outward remittances, helping businesses reduce costs, improve cash flow, and navigate global trade with ease.
